The Coaching Skills
Workshop
This
intense one day workshop is practice based and skill oriented to
address issues that managers deal with on the job. Participants
will be introduced to the Five-Step Coaching Model, which will act
as the blueprint to build the skills, abilities, and confidence
necessary to be highly effective coaches.
This interactive session, split into three
modules, is designed to be facilitated by a trainer-coach that has
the experience and actively models the skills being developed. It
will cover coaching situations encountered by the participants and
will allow them the opportunity to introduce the existing issues
that they are dealing with.
